Kremlin prepares large-scale propaganda campaign in Global South countries, CCD says

Ukrinform
Russian state television company RT will hold a festival in more than 15 countries in Asia and Africa to justify the aggression against Ukraine and the crimes of the Russian invaders.

According to Ukrinform, the Center for Countering Disinformation at the National Security and Defense Council reported this on Telegram.

“As part of the festival, documentary films justifying Russian aggression against Ukraine and the crimes of Russian occupiers, cultivating hatred toward Western countries, and promoting Russian influence will be shown in Zambia, Afghanistan, Niger, Pakistan, Tanzania, and other countries,” the statement said.

It is noted that, to spread its influence worldwide, the Kremlin continues to use “Russian houses” (Russian Centres for Science and Culture) under the guise of cultural and educational cooperation.

“The real goal of the Russian Federation's pseudo-cultural events is to expand its geopolitical presence in the Global South, promote its own ideology, and recruit mercenaries for the war against Ukraine,” the CCD said.

As reported by Ukrinform, the Kenyan parliament stated that Russia had recruited more than a thousand citizens of that country to participate in the war against Ukraine, using tourist visa schemes and promises of high salaries.
